I'm not positive, but this sounds like maybe you're trying to load PowerPC plugins in the Intel-native T3. You can try launching T3 under Rosetta and seeing if your plugins reappear. (T2 is PowerPC only, so it always runs under Rosetta.)Sangsara wrote:Mac OS X 10.4.11
